1. The Power of Circadian Rhythms in Meal Timing
One of the most exciting breakthroughs in the study of meal timing is its connection to our body’s natural circadian rhythms. Our bodies are biologically programmed to function optimally at certain times of day, influenced by the sleep-wake cycle. Research has shown that eating in sync with your internal clock can lead to better digestion, enhanced metabolic efficiency, and improved weight regulation.
Experts say: Dr. Satchin Panda, a leading researcher in the field of chronobiology, emphasizes the importance of aligning food intake with your body’s circadian rhythms. His studies suggest that eating during the daylight hours and fasting at night can significantly improve metabolic health. This idea is rooted in the fact that our bodies are designed to process food more efficiently during the daytime when the digestive system is most active.
What it means for you: If you’re looking to optimize your metabolism, experts recommend eating during an 8-12 hour window during the day. For example, if you have breakfast at 8 a.m., aim to have your last meal by 6 p.m. This ensures that your body has adequate time to rest and recover during the night, which is when metabolism naturally slows down.
2. Meal Timing and Insulin Sensitivity
Insulin sensitivity refers to how effectively the body responds to insulin, the hormone responsible for regulating blood sugar levels. Poor insulin sensitivity is a hallmark of metabolic diseases like Type 2 diabetes. Interestingly, the timing of your meals can have a direct impact on how insulin functions in the body.
Experts say: Dr. David Ludwig, an obesity researcher at Harvard Medical School, points to the importance of meal timing in regulating insulin sensitivity. He explains that eating larger meals earlier in the day can help maintain healthy insulin levels, whereas eating late at night can lead to impaired insulin sensitivity and higher blood sugar levels. This is because the body’s ability to process glucose tends to diminish as the day progresses.
What it means for you: If managing blood sugar is a priority—whether for weight management or overall health—consider having your largest meal in the earlier part of the day. This helps prevent late-night spikes in blood sugar and ensures that the body has time to process nutrients when insulin is most effective.
3. Time-Restricted Eating (TRE): A Game-Changer for Weight Loss
Intermittent fasting (IF) has become a buzzword in health and fitness circles, and its cousin, Time-Restricted Eating (TRE), is gaining traction as an effective weight loss strategy. The principle behind TRE is simple: restricting your eating window to a set number of hours each day, typically 8-10 hours, and fasting for the remaining hours. This approach has shown promising results not just for weight loss, but also for improving metabolic health and longevity.
Experts say: Dr. Mark Mattson, a neuroscientist at Johns Hopkins University, is a pioneer in researching the benefits of intermittent fasting and TRE. His studies suggest that fasting for extended periods—especially when coupled with proper meal timing—can help the body burn fat more effectively, improve brain function, and reduce the risk of chronic diseases such as heart disease and diabetes.
What it means for you: If you’re looking to improve both your health and body composition, a daily fasting window can be beneficial. For instance, an 8-hour eating window (e.g., 12 p.m. to 8 p.m.) can help reduce calorie intake while enhancing the body’s natural fat-burning processes. Moreover, it allows your digestive system time to rest and rejuvenate during the fasting period.
4. Smaller, More Frequent Meals: Fact or Fiction?
For decades, conventional wisdom suggested that eating smaller, more frequent meals throughout the day could boost metabolism and prevent overeating. The logic behind this was that constantly feeding the body would keep blood sugar stable and prevent hunger pangs. However, recent research has raised questions about the effectiveness of this approach for everyone.
Experts say: Dr. James Betts, a leading researcher in nutrition, argues that the idea of eating frequently to boost metabolism doesn’t have a strong scientific foundation. His research shows that eating the same number of calories spread over several small meals doesn’t necessarily increase metabolic rate or improve fat loss compared to eating fewer meals with larger portions. In fact, for many people, more frequent eating can lead to mindless snacking and overeating.
What it means for you: Rather than focusing on the number of meals you eat per day, experts now recommend listening to your body’s hunger signals and choosing meal timing that fits with your natural eating habits. Whether you prefer three larger meals or five smaller ones, the key is to maintain a balance of nutrients and avoid overeating.
5. The Role of Protein Timing in Muscle Maintenance
For those looking to build or maintain muscle mass, the timing of protein consumption can make a significant difference. Protein is essential for muscle repair and growth, and consuming it at the right times can maximize its benefits.
Experts say: Dr. Stuart Phillips, a professor at McMaster University and a leading expert in exercise nutrition, highlights the importance of distributing protein intake evenly throughout the day. Rather than consuming the majority of your protein at dinner, spreading protein across meals helps optimize muscle protein synthesis (the process by which the body repairs and builds muscle).
What it means for you: If muscle maintenance or growth is a goal, experts recommend consuming 20-30 grams of protein at each meal, spread evenly across breakfast, lunch, and dinner. This ensures a steady supply of amino acids to support muscle repair and prevents muscle breakdown, especially when combined with regular strength training.
6. Avoid Late-Night Eating for Better Sleep Quality
Eating late at night has been associated with disturbed sleep patterns and poor digestion, which can undermine your overall health and performance the next day. Many people experience indigestion, acid reflux, or an inability to fall asleep when they consume large meals just before bed.
Experts say: Dr. Charles Czeisler, a renowned sleep expert at Harvard Medical School, explains that eating late disrupts the body’s natural sleep-wake cycle. Late-night meals can interfere with the body’s production of melatonin, the hormone responsible for regulating sleep, and also increase the likelihood of acid reflux and discomfort during the night.
What it means for you: To improve sleep quality and avoid disrupting your circadian rhythms, experts recommend finishing your last meal at least 2-3 hours before going to bed. If you must eat later in the evening, opt for a light snack, such as a handful of nuts or a small serving of Greek yogurt, rather than a heavy or high-sugar meal.
7. Meal Timing and Gut Health: The Microbiome Connection
Recent research is beginning to explore the fascinating link between meal timing and the health of our gut microbiome—the trillions of bacteria that play a crucial role in digestion, immunity, and even mood regulation. Emerging evidence suggests that meal timing can influence the diversity and composition of these gut bacteria, with implications for overall health.
Experts say: Dr. Rob Knight, a microbiome expert at the University of California, suggests that eating at irregular times or consuming large meals late at night can disrupt the microbiome, leading to imbalances that could contribute to metabolic diseases. Additionally, eating in alignment with circadian rhythms may support the growth of beneficial bacteria, promoting a healthy digestive system.
What it means for you: To support a balanced microbiome, aim for consistent meal times and avoid eating too late at night. Consuming a varied and fiber-rich diet will also help foster a healthy gut microbiome, benefiting your digestion, immune function, and overall well-being.
